from a short, woody rhizome. Stems slender, branched, more or less decumbent, 10-20cm in length. Basal leaves ovate-cordate, sharply toothed, usually withered at flowering time. Flowers 1.5-2cm long, bell-shaped with broad flared lobes, deep lilac. Southwestern Yugoslavia in limestone crevices and cliffs. C.h. 'Nana' is dwarfer, and more usually seen in gardens.
